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Court involvement in family law matters can arise when disputes escalate or parties cannot reach agreement through negotiation or mediation. Whether your case will require a court appearance ultimately depends on several factors, including the nature of the dispute, how willing parties are to collaborate on a resolution, and the complexity of the issues at hand. Many family law matters are resolved without formal court proceedings, but some circumstances may necessitate judicial intervention. Based on your location in Roseville, NSW, one nearby court location is: Manly Court House 2 Belgrave Street, Manly This location is provided for general context only. Family law matters are typically handled in the Family Court of Australia or the Local Court, depending on the complexity and type of dispute involved.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Family Law lawyers cost in Roseville, NSW?
Family Law lawyers in Roseville, NSW typically charge between $300 and $600 per hour. These hourly rates vary based on the lawyer's experience, location and the firm, though the total cost of your matter depends on how much time is required. Straightforward matters, such as basic advice or document preparation, may require fewer hours and therefore cost less overall. Contested parenting disputes or property settlement negotiations often take more time and preparation, while complex cases involving lengthy court proceedings or high-conflict situations require significantly more work and result in higher total costs.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Family Law lawyer in Roseville, NSW?
When meeting with a family law lawyer in Roseville, NSW, it can help to have current photo identification and recent financial documentation such as bank statements, tax returns, and superannuation details available. If your matter involves children, birth certificates and any existing parenting arrangements or court orders may be useful to provide. For property disputes, mortgage documents, property valuations, and asset statements can assist your lawyer in understanding your circumstances.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ation. Some Australia Post offices offer services like certified copies, photo ID, or printing.
